How to fill out chase health savings account
How to fill out Chase Health Savings Account (HSA)
01
Visit the Chase website or your nearest Chase branch to get the necessary application form.
02
Provide your personal information, including your name, address, and social security number.
03
Indicate your eligibility based on having a qualifying high-deductible health plan (HDHP).
04
Decide on your initial contribution amount to fund the HSA.
05
Fill out information regarding your HDHP coverage and provider details.
06
Review the terms and conditions associated with the HSA.
07
Submit the completed application form to Chase for processing.
Who needs Chase Health Savings Account (HSA)?
01
Individuals or families enrolled in a high-deductible health plan (HDHP).
02
Those seeking a tax-advantaged savings account for medical expenses.
03
People looking to save for future healthcare costs, including retirees.
04
Individuals who want to reduce their taxable income through contributions.

What is the difference between HSA and health savings account?
Both accounts let you make pre-tax contributions and grow tax-free earnings. But only an HSA lets you take tax-free distributions for qualified medical expenses. After age 65 you can use your health savings account for any expense, you'll simply pay ordinary income taxes — just like a 401(k).
Does Chase bank offer HSA accounts?
The Chase HSA is a special tax-advantaged account that is used with a high-deductible health plan "HDHP," and allows you and your family members to pay for various qualified medical expenses (PDF) — from co-payments at your doctor's office to pharmacy bills, dental care, vision care, and more.

What is Chase Health Savings Account (HSA)?
Chase Health Savings Account (HSA) is a tax-advantaged savings account that allows individuals to save money for medical expenses. Contributions to the account are tax-deductible and can be used tax-free for qualified medical expenses.
Who is required to file Chase Health Savings Account (HSA)?
Individuals who contribute to a Health Savings Account (HSA) are required to file if they want to claim the tax benefits. Additionally, any individual who takes distributions from the account must file to report the withdrawals.
How to fill out Chase Health Savings Account (HSA)?
To fill out a Chase Health Savings Account (HSA), you typically need to complete an application form provided by Chase, ensuring you meet eligibility requirements, such as being enrolled in a high-deductible health plan (HDHP).
What is the purpose of Chase Health Savings Account (HSA)?
The purpose of the Chase Health Savings Account (HSA) is to provide individuals with a way to save money, on a tax-free basis, for future medical expenses. It encourages saving for healthcare costs while offering tax benefits.
What information must be reported on Chase Health Savings Account (HSA)?
When filing taxes related to a Chase Health Savings Account (HSA), individuals must report contributions made to the account, distributions received, and any taxable income generated from the account. Form 8889 is commonly used for this reporting.
